Blur background in your images

Want to highlight the subject in your images with a single click? Here's how you can quickly do it in Photoshop.

Quickly highlight the subject in your image by blurring the background to create incredible depth in your image.

Open your image in Photoshop and follow the quick steps below to get the desired result:

  1. You can access the Discover Panel in Photoshop using the search icon at the upper right of the app workspace. Alternatively, you can use the Cmd/Ctrl + F keyboard shortcut or choose Help > Photoshop Help from the menu bar.

  2. In the Discover panel, navigate to the Browse > Quick Actions and select Blur background

  3. Click the Apply button to blur the background and highlight the subject to create a one-of-a-kind image.

  4. (Optional) To try on a different layer, select the one your want from the Layers panel and click Refresh to resume.

  5. Click the Revert button to undo the applied changes. To find more quick actions that you can apply to your image, click Browse more quick actions.
